The Signs A Pipe May Need Relining

If you’re unsure whether your pipes need relining, here’s the signs to watch out for:

  • Water leakage
  • Unpleasant odors emanating from your drains
  • You hear gurgling noises coming from the drains
  • Clogs or slow drainage

Is It Best To Have My Pipe Replaced or Relined?

It is a question most homeowners must consider at some point. Both options are a choice with pros and cons and it isn’t easy to determine which is the very best choice for you. Here are a few things to think about:

Relining

  • Relining is much less expensive than replacing.
  • You can do it without tearing out your floors or walls.
  • It is imaginable to complete it quickly typically in one or two days.
  • There is less of a mess to make after the project is completed.
  • The new liner will last for many years.

Replacement

  • The cost of replacement is higher than Relining.
  • It’s not a clean job and you might require to move out of home home for a couple of days during the time it’s being done.
  • The new pipe should last for many years.

Is It Possible To Reline Pipes With Bends In Them?

Yes trenchless pipe relining is an excellent, no-dig solution to repair damaged pipes that have bends in the pipes. The pipe relining process creates an entirely new pipe inside the existing pipe. This means you don’t need to take out the old pipe and can fix it without having to dig out your driveway or garden.

The difficulties of a pipe-relining job is increased with the number of bends in the pipe. Our experts have lined many sewer lines with bends.

Although this can be challenging, it is not impossible and we’ve got the knowledge and expertise to get the job done right.

What’s the difference between Pipe Relining And Pipe Replacement?

Pipe relining creates a new pipe inside of the existing one, while pipe burst disintegrates the old pipe and replaces it by a new one.

Pipe relining tends to be less invasive and is an cost-effective alternative to pipe replacement. Talk to an expert about your specific needs to figure out which solution is the best fit for your needs.

Does Pipe Relining Alter Pipe Flow?

There is rarely a decrease in the flow of pipes due to pipe relining. Relining pipes can increase your flow that flows through the pipe as it creates the new smooth area for water to flow through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Around?

Pipe relining has been used for a long time, the first instance of its use occurring in 1854. But it wasn’t until the beginning of the 2000’s that it began to be more commonly used.

Today, pipe relining technology is used all over the globe as a successful solution to fix leaks or damaged pipes, without the need to tear them out and replace them completely. There are many different types of pipe relining solutions that can be used dependent on the kind of pipe and the degree in the extent of damage.

There is, for instance, spot pipe relining Glendenning, which is used to fix small leaks and structural pipe relining, which is used to repair more severe damage. Whichever type of pipe relining is utilised however, the goal remains the same: fixing the pipe without replacing it entirely.

This alternative that does not need excavation can save time and money and it’s also a more sustainable option than replacing the pipe.
